small and fast (not the fastest... but its QUICK!) try a Sig Kobra. Its a fairly simple kit designed for the style Pattern flying done in the 1970's... quick flying actrross the field and doing one "show stopper" maneuver in the center, converting all the speed you had built up into the vertical performance needed.
Very fast with a light weight .40 (plenty fast with a strong .25 really.) and its a stable design. No bad characteristics to get you in over your head.
A little larger, same design really is the Sig Kougar. Meant to be flown with a .40.. the airframe canhandle a .60 for speed runs.
Remember... as you add power you normally add weight. There is a point where the added weight harms performance so much that the plane actually becomes slower.
